A Different Kind of Dietetic Support
Our paediatric dietitians offers neuro-affirming, gender-affirming, and weight-inclusive care, with a focus on creating small, achievable changes that help children feel safe and confident around food.
We understand that every child is different — and so are their feeding needs, preferences, and challenges. That’s why we take a whole-child approach, focusing not just on nutrition, but also on emotional well-being, sensory needs, identity, and family dynamics.

How We Work With Families
Our support is centred around building trust, reducing stress, and helping families move toward more peaceful mealtimes. This may include:
-
Feeding therapy and safe food exploration
-
Nutrition guidance that respects sensory and emotional needs
-
Mealtime routines that work in your household
-
Support with medical nutrition, including supplements
-
Empowering parents and caregivers with tools and confidence
-
Education for schools, support workers, and extended care teams
We don’t believe in “fixing” kids or forcing foods. Instead, we focus on creating positive food experiences that help your child build confidence, connection, and curiosity — in their own way and at their own pace.
Our Core Values
At Eat Love Live, our work is guided by a compassionate, evidence-informed philosophy:
-
Neuro-affirming care: Respecting and working with the way your child’s brain works
-
Gender-affirming care: Supporting young people in bodies that reflect their identity
-
Weight-inclusive care: Focusing on health, nourishment, and quality of life — not weight
-
Holistic care: Looking at the whole child — their body, brain, environment, and story
